# 1.运行mongDB
docker pull mongo:${version} #version代表版本号
docker run -d -p 27017:27017 --name mongodb mongo ---无须权限
docker logs -f mongodb --查看mongo运行日志
# 2.进入mongodb容器
docker exec -it mongodb /bin/bash
# 3.常见具有权限的容器
docker run --name mongodb -p 27017:27017 -d mongo --auth
# 4.进入容器配置用户名密码
mongo
use admin 选择admin库
db.createUser({user:"root",pwd:"root",roles:[{role:'root',db:'admin'}]}) //创建用户,此用户创建成功,则后续操作都需要用户认证
exit
# 5.将mongoDB中数据目录映射到宿主机中
docker run -d -p 27017:27017 -v /data0/mongodb/data:/data/db --name mongodb mongo